Color is the most effective way of creating a mood for any room. While choosing a color scheme for living rooms as part of your interior painting, it is important to choose one which is Color Scheme for Living Roomsstylish but practical. For example, if you select white for your living room, then you cannot expect it to be easy to maintain (especially if you have children!) To pick out living room color schemes, there are three options:
Use one color, but varying shades of that color throughout the room
Use two or more colors that are similar to each other, or complement each other, to give a tranquil and warm feeling to the room.
Use two contrasting colors. This kind of a look makes the room vibrant and alive.
Once you have selected the kind of color scheme you want, it will be easier to choose living room color combinations. Besides just choosing colors that you like, you can also try and understand the psychology of colors for creating a warm and inviting feeling. The following are a few decorating ideas for living room color schemes:

Red: One of the most popular colors for living room design ideas is red. It gives a feeling of intimacy and warmth. It is best if you use red for one wall, as using it everywhere can make the room look over the top. For the other walls of the room, go for lighter shades like cream or beige.

Orange: Like red, orange is a very bright color which makes a person feel right at home. Using shades of orange in living room color schemes brightens up the room, making one feel welcomed. If you are going for this color, then your furniture and accessories should be of neutral colors. Another option of living room color designs is using orange color only in accessories, and using black or white for the walls.

Blue: Blue is a tranquil color which brings elegance into your home. Light shades of blue are best for smaller living rooms, as they make them appear larger. You can play around with various shades of blue, like pastel blue, Mediterranean azure, turquoise, navy etc. Turquoise looks great with bold jewels and a contemporary living room furniture design, though it might not be the best choice for a traditional decor.

Green: Bright green is used very often in color schemes for living room these days. It is easy to play around with, and looks great when paired with neutrals and deep browns. Again, it's best if you use green only in accents, and not for everything in the room! You can use different shades of green, like mint, olive and exotic jade for a feel of fresh and airy spring time living room color themes. Read more on living room designs and ideas.

Shades of White and Gray: If you want living room color schemes which ooze of class and sophistication, then using white and gray in your home decor is a great choice. But this does not mean that you have to use only these shades throughout. Play around with shades like blue and warm gold tones in the upholstery, table cloths, accessories etc. But remember that white is not the best choice for maintenance!
